Fertőrákos mithraeum
Photo: Fekist,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Fertőrákos Mithraeum is a temple to the Roman god Mithras at Fertőrákos in Hungary. The temple, follows a typical plan of a narthex followed by the shrine proper that consists of a sunken central nave with podium benches on either side. Fertőrákos
Village
Photo: Joadl,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Fertőrákos is a village in the county of Győr-Moson-Sopron in Hungary. In 2001 it had a population of 2,182. It is located at, about 10 km from Sopron, near Lake Fertő and the Austrian border. Fertőrákos is situated 4½ km south of Katholische Kirche Mörbisch am See.

Rust
Photo: Jacquesverlaeken,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Rust is a city at the Neusiedl Lake in Burgenland, Austria. It is a part of the cultural landscape nominated on the UNESCO World Heritage List. The town is known for the storks nesting over its chimneys and for its beautiful historic centre.
